Dyrup chooses the colour of the year 2025
Violet Faisan: The colour that reflects the balance between mystery and serenity.
PPG Dyrup has just chosen the colour of the year 2025 – Violet Faisan CH2 0514 – a shade that translates the warmth and mystery between blue and red, distinguished by its ability to create sophisticated atmospheres while promoting creativity and tranquillity.
Violet Faisan, identified by PPG Dyrup’s colour and trend experts, is a versatile shade for interiors and exteriors, traditionally associated with introspection and well-being. In convivial spaces, such as the living room, it offers a cosy and elegant atmosphere, while in more reserved environments, such as the bedroom, it enhances a calming effect. Applied as a highlight colour or in monochrome, it adds depth and refinement to environments, highlighting decorative elements.

Violet Faisan is available in PPG Dyrup’s colour tuning system – SPECTRON – awarded the Five Star Prize as the colour tuning system chosen by the Portuguese. This colour can be tuned in various types of products, such as interior paints, exterior paints, enamels and some wood products. This system gives products greater durability, resistance and opacity.
